Adventure Tips

Bring Reef-Safe Sunscreen

Protect your skin and the marine environment by choosing reef-safe sunscreen for your trip.

Check Tide Schedules

Paddling is easier and more enjoyable during high tides when water levels are optimal for navigating the tunnels.

Wear Lightweight, Quick-Dry Clothing

Dress in comfortable apparel that dries quickly to stay comfortable throughout your paddle.

Keep a Safe Distance from Wildlife

Respect local wildlife by maintaining a safe distance to avoid disturbing them, especially manatees and birds.

History

The Lido Key Mangrove Tunnels have long served as crucial nurseries for marine species integral to the Gulf Coast ecosystem.

Conservation

Sea Life Kayak Adventures encourages paddlers to minimize disturbance by sticking to marked waterways and using reef-friendly products.
